About Bernard Broermann
Bernard Broermann is the founder of Asklepios Kliniken GmbH, one of the three largest operators of private hospitals in Germany.
His first hospital opened in 1984, and the group now employs more than 50,000 people and has 170 hospitals and medical clinics worldwide.
Asklepios holds a majority stake in mediClin AG, a German operator of hospitals and clinics.
In May 2020, the Bundeskartellamt cleared Asklepios's planned acquisition of of rival hospital group Rhoen-Klinikum AG, in which it already held a stake; today it holds 91.75% of the group.
Broermann also owns five luxury hotels in Germany and Switzerland.
